Synchronisation avec un fichier properties

Soyez le premier à donner votre avis sur cette source.

Vue 7 467 fois - Téléchargée 540 fois

Description

Cette api gère la synchronisation avec un fichier properties.
De plus, elle permet de créer des listeners sur les propriétés (synchro avec le fichier properties, la valeur d'une propriété à changé etc...).
Ideal pour gérer facilement les préférences utilisateurs.

Le fichier zip contient un exemple, la javadoc pour les utilisateurs de l'api (seuls les membres
protected et public sont visibles) et une autre pour sa mieux se représenter l'api au complet afin de la modifier à sa guise (tous les membres sont visibles).

Codes Sources

A voir également

Ajouter un commentaire

Commentaires

codefalse
Messages postés
1127
Date d'inscription
mardi 8 janvier 2002
Statut
Modérateur
Dernière intervention
21 avril 2009
1
ok merci ! :)
Twinuts
Messages postés
5345
Date d'inscription
dimanche 4 mai 2003
Statut
Modérateur
Dernière intervention
11 février 2020
90
Salut,

en gros cela veut dire simplement qu'a un instant donné tu es le seul à pouvoir accéder au fichier
codefalse
Messages postés
1127
Date d'inscription
mardi 8 janvier 2002
Statut
Modérateur
Dernière intervention
21 avril 2009
1
excusez moi mais je ne comprends pas ce que vous voulez dire par Synchronisation avec un fichier ?
Je connais les termes de synchronisation mais pas avec un fichier ?!
Pourriez vous m'expliquer s'il vous plait ?
merci :)
Twinuts
Messages postés
5345
Date d'inscription
dimanche 4 mai 2003
Statut
Modérateur
Dernière intervention
11 février 2020
90
Salut,

"Si mon constructeur est en private" <- milles excuses je viens seulement de le voir caché entre deux commentaires :D si le constructeur est private comme c'est le cas et que l'instance interne est static alors pas de risque le singleton fonctionne :)
romuluslepunk
Messages postés
11
Date d'inscription
mercredi 10 août 2005
Statut
Membre
Dernière intervention
6 décembre 2006

Si mon constructeur est en private, il est impossible de faire :
ConfigManager myconfigs = new ConfigManager();
Sauf au sein de la la classe ConfigManager. Du moins mon Eclipse ne l'autorise pas donc il y a certainement erreur de compilation (au pire je testerai une compilation en console).

Si je fait :
private ConfigManager mesConfig1 = ConfigManager.getInstance();
private ConfigManager mesConfig2 = ConfigManager.getInstance();
Les 2 objets devrait pointer vers l'objet instance ?
Je vais faire des tests (il ya plus de chances que tu aie raison que le contraire :) )


Super pour le shutdown, je pense que je vais :
- faire hérité Thread à ConfigManager
- ajouter le blocage et addShuttdownhook(this) dans la methode synchronise
- supprimer le blocage et removeShuttdownhook(this) dans la methode desynchronise
- copier le contenue de la methode desynchronise dans la methode run (sauf removeShuttdownhook(this)...)
C'est ce qui me parait être le plus simple.

Ce week-end celà devrait être testé au niveau du singleton et le shutdown réalisé.


Un grand merci

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.

Du même auteur (romuluslepunk)